Deadmau5 Opens New Community Forum For Paid Subscribers

by Matthew Meadow
July 31, 2019
in EDM News
deadmau5

A post on the Deadmau5 subreddit was shared today, titled, “Do you remember when you could watch Joel stream, interact with him and get teasers of his new music for free? I Remember.” Joel, aka Deadmau5, used to stream on Twitch either playing video games or making music.

In February earlier this year, Deadmau5 received a suspension from the platform for his use of the word “fag” on stream. In response, he deleted his whole Twitch account in protest of the platform’s apparent double standards. “I’m not going to stand for Twitch’s double standard when it comes to censoring and suspending me for harmless shit,” he shared with his community on Reddit.

Now, Deadmau5 has created a community of his own and is asking fans to subscribe for content. It’s not all that different from Twitch, where a subscription to a streamer also cost $5/mo. But with the Deadmau5 community, he has full creative control over what is shared, what is behind that pay wall, and what kind of exclusive content he offers.

  • Access to deadmau5’s gameplay with commenting, AMAs, or other live videostreams
  • First teasers of releases of new music, videos and other content directly from deadmau5
  • Ability to Chat with deadmau5 in the Forums
  • First access to exclusive merchandise.
  • First access to ticketing and experience opportunities
  • Discounts on merchandise

While the tone of the title was rather morose, the comments in the post were largely supportive of the move. And why not? As one user put it, “It’s more than what a twitch subscription got you for the same price, and they’re doing the heavy lifting of running the platform – rather than simply using one. that takes time and deserves compensation. IMO. […] I think it’s a fucking good deal.”
